(d) "Prescribed" means prescribed by rules or regulations framed under this Act. Constitution of U.P. Rakshak Dal 3- There shall be raised and maintained a force to be designated "the United Provinces Rakshak Dal" hereinafter called the Rakshak Dal and it shall be constituted in such manner as may be prescribed. Enrolment 4- Subject to such conditions as may be prescribed, any person may be enrolled as a member of the Rakshak Dal and his conditions of service shall be such as may be prescribed. Functions 5- A member of the Rakshak Dal when called upon to do so by the prescribed authority in relation to the preservation of public peace and for the protection of inhabitants and the security of property in any area within [Uttar Pradesh]1 as such prescribed authority may direct. Declaration 6- Every member of the Rakshak Dal, shall on enrolment, make a declaration in the form given in the Schedule. Powers protection and control etc. 7- (1) For the enforcement of the provision of this Act or any rule or regulation made thereunder every member of the Rakshak Dal, shall, when on duty or called for duty be deemed to be a police officer, and subject to any terms, conditions and restrictions as may be prescribed, to have and be subject to, in so far as it is not inconsistent with this Act, all the powers, privileges, liabilities and protections as a police officer duly appointed has or is subject to by virtue of the Police Act, 1861 (save section 29 thereof) or of may other law for the time being in force. (2) No prosecution shall be instituted against a member of the Rakshak Dal in respect of anything done or purported to be done by him in discharge of his functions as such member except with the previous sanction of the authority prescribed in that behalf. (3) The superintendence of the Force in an area shall vest in such officer or officers as may be appointed by the [State Government]2. Period of service and discharge 8- Every-member of the Rakshak Dal shall be required to serve the [State Government]2 for such period as may be prescribed. He shall, thereafter, be called up for duty at any time during a further period as may be prescribed. After the expiry of such further period the member shall be deemed to have been discharged from the Rakshak Dal.
